When It’s Time to Get Your AC Repaired
Is the level of comfort in your house disappointing what you would like it to be? There are other, more subtle problems that, if disregarded, might lead to more serious repair work or the need for an early replacement of your air conditioning system. While a system that will not turn on is a clear sign that you need repair work, there are other, less obvious problems. If you recognize with the more subtle indications of a problem with your a/c, you will be able to call a expert service professional quicker rather than later on.
If any of the following use, one of our Iowa AC repair professionals encourages that you give us a call:
- You are incurring an increase in the quantity of cash required to pay for your month-to-month energy bills: Inefficient operation of your ac system can be brought on by a number of various issues, including dripping ductwork, an internal breakdown, or a faulty thermostat. This means that it has to work more difficult to keep your property cool, which will result in a substantial boost in the amount that you pay in energy costs.
- You just see hot air coming out of your vents: First things first, ensure you have not unintentionally set the thermostat to the incorrect temperature level by examining it. If that is not the case, then you more than likely have a problem on the inside of your ac system, and you must get it inspected by a expert.
- You are seeing a greater humidity level at your residential or commercial property: Even though this is not the primary function of your air conditioning unit, it is accountable for controling the humidity level inside of your home or business building. Higher humidity indicates that there is an excess of wetness in the air, which can cause the growth of mold and mildew in addition to making the air feel warm and sticky. It is essential that you get this matter dealt with as rapidly as humanly feasible, especially for the sake of your security.
- The air flow in your unit is inadequate: Regrettably, there are a wide variety of aspects that can lead to inadequate air flow. We will require to perform a extensive examination in order to figure out whether the issue is the result of a blocked air filter, an problem with the blower, frozen evaporator coils, leaking ductwork, or blocked duct.
- You observe that there is a considerable quantity of wetness in the location around your unit: Condensation is a natural event, nevertheless it shouldn’t exist in extreme quantities. It is possible that you have a leaking refrigerant or a blocked drain tube if you see any excess wetness or pooling water in the location.
- Unusual Noises from Your Unit: It is to be anticipated for an air conditioner to produce some background noise while it is running. On the other hand, if it starts making audible shrieking, screeching, grinding, groaning, or scraping noises, this is an apparent indicator that something requires to be fixed.
- It appears that there is a problem with your thermostat: It’s possible that the thermostat is the source of the issues you’re having with your air conditioner. If you have cold and hot locations around your home, your system will not shut down, or it won’t start, it could be because of a problem with the thermostat. If your system will not start, it could also be because it won’t shut off.
- Foul odors are coming from your system: There may be a problem with your AC if you smell anything burning or a musty odor. These smells can be brought on by a range of aspects, consisting of mold advancement and charred electrical wiring.
- Your unit rotates often between the following states: When the temperature level inside your home reaches the level that you have actually chosen on the thermostat, a/c unit are programmed to switch off immediately. Despite this, it will continue to cycle even when there is something incorrect with it.

The HVAC System Is Making Weird Noises
There are a few sounds that must not be heard originating from a/c unit even though they do not operate in full silence. These sounds might be anything from a banging to a screeching to a grinding to a clicking noise. These particular sounds often suggest that there is a problem within the cooling unit that has to be repaired by a professional of in Polk County.
Sounds that are Weird and Different Coming From Your air conditioner The following must be included:
- Banging: The issue is normally the compressor in an a/c that is making a banging sound. This element of the ac system is responsible for providing refrigerant to the various other components of the unit in order to eliminate excess heat from your home. Compressor parts may chill out as the air conditioning system ages. This sound is brought on by the parts moving and rattling and crashing one another.
- Shrieking: A broken blower fan motor within the air conditioning unit may produce a sound similar to screeching or screeching if the motor is working improperly. Normally, a malfunctioning fan belt or broken bearings in the motor are to blame for this noise. Switch off the air conditioning right away and get in touch with a expert for repair work whenever you hear a shrieking noise.
- Grinding: The sound of something grinding is never ever a great sign to hear originating from any kind of mechanical object. Pistons inside the compressor may have worn out, which may result in this grinding sound originating from the a/c. When a compressor’s pistons become worn, it usually shows that the compressor itself has to be changed. The total AC unit could require to be replaced depending upon the design of a/c and how old it is.
- Clicking: It is really typical for an ac system to make a clicking noise when it initially switches on. If you hear clicking throughout the entire duration of the cooling cycle, then there is a issue with the clicking. These clicks are the result of a thermostat that is not working correctly.
